                    @Braden-Hallett when you approach the silhouettes for these characters how do you do it? Trees are easier for me. Do you have a character design in mind, and then add shapes or how do you build your silhouette? Thanks I know this is a gallery, it’s not a critique it’s a question lols.

                      @Heather-Boyd

                      It depends! Sometimes I'll use the silhouette for more of a pose, sometimes I'll try and really figure out the shape of the characters. Sometimes I'll do a sihl for pose and then a sihl overtop for the actual silhouette. I'll usually do little studies for faces, interesting props and stuff before putting them together.
